#E9C0D5 contains red, green and blue colors in about the same proportion. Web safe color of #E9C0D5 is #FFCCCC (or #FCC).
#E9C0D5 color RGB value is (233,192,213).
RGB: (233,192,213) (91%,75%,84%)
R 233 of 255 = 91%
G 192 of 255 = 75%
B 213 of 255 = 84%
R + G + B ~ 83%. #E9C0D5 is quite light color.
R + G + B =
233 + 192 + 213 = 638 (100%)
R 233 of 638 ~ 36.52%
G 192 of 638 ~ 30.09%
B 213 of 638 ~ 33.39%
#E9C0D5 color CMYK value is (0,18,9,9).
CMYK: (0,18,9,9) C0M18Y9K9 (0%,18%,9%,9%) (0.00/0.18/0.09/0.09)
